Производится двухканальная (стерео) звукозапись с частотой дискретизации 16 кГц и глубиной кодирования...

Тематика Информатика
Уровень 10 - 11 классы
стереозвук звукозапись частота дискретизации глубина кодирования 16 кГц 32 бит 12 минут размер файла мегабайты несжатые данные
0

Производится двухканальная (стерео) звукозапись с частотой дискретизации 16 кГц и глубиной кодирования 32 бит. Запись длится 12 минут, ее результаты записываются в файл, сжатие данных не производится. Какое из приведенных ниже чисел наиболее близко к размеру полученного файла, выраженному в мегабайтах?

avatar
задан 4 месяца назад

3 Ответа

0

Размер полученного файла можно вычислить по формуле: Размер файла = (частота дискретизации глубина кодирования каналы * время записи) / 8 / 1024 / 1024

Подставляем данные из условия: (16000 32 2 12 60) / 8 / 1024 / 1024 ≈ 1386 МБ

Наиболее близкое число к размеру файла будет 1400 МБ.

avatar
ответил 4 месяца назад
0

Для решения этой задачи нужно рассчитать объем данных, который будет занимать двухканальная (стерео) звукозапись с заданными параметрами.

  1. Частота дискретизации: 16 кГц. Это означает, что за одну секунду производится 16 000 измерений (или отсчетов) звукового сигнала.

  2. Глубина кодирования: 32 бита. Каждый отсчет звукового сигнала представляется 32 битами (или 4 байтами, поскольку 1 байт = 8 бит).

  3. Длительность записи: 12 минут. Переведем минуты в секунды: 12 минут * 60 секунд/минуту = 720 секунд.

  4. Двухканальная запись (стерео): Для стереозаписи данные записываются для двух каналов одновременно, поэтому количество данных удваивается.

Теперь рассчитаем общий объем данных:

  1. Объем данных за одну секунду: Количество отсчетов за секунду для одного канала: 16 000 отсчетов/сек. Глубина кодирования: 32 бита (или 4 байта). Для одного канала за одну секунду: 16 000 отсчетов * 4 байта = 64 000 байт.

  2. Для двух каналов за одну секунду: 64 000 байт (для одного канала) * 2 = 128 000 байт.

  3. Для всей записи (720 секунд): 128 000 байт/сек * 720 секунд = 92 160 000 байт.

  4. Перевод в мегабайты: 1 мегабайт = 1 048 576 байт (2^20 байт).

    92 160 000 байт / 1 048 576 байт/мегабайт ≈ 87.9 мегабайта.

Таким образом, размер полученного файла будет приблизительно 87.9 мегабайта.

avatar
ответил 4 месяца назад
0

Для расчета размера файла необходимо учитывать следующие параметры:

  1. Частота дискретизации: 16 кГц (16 000 Гц)
  2. Глубина кодирования: 32 бита (4 байта)
  3. Длительность записи: 12 минут

Для расчета объема файла используем формулу:

Объем файла = Частота дискретизации Глубина кодирования Длительность записи

Объем файла = 16 000 4 12 * 60 (переводим минуты в секунды) бит

Объем файла = 16 000 4 720 бит

Объем файла = 46 080 000 бит

Для перевода бит в мегабайты (1 байт = 8 бит):

46 080 000 / 8 = 5 760 000 байт

Далее переводим байты в мегабайты (1 мегабайт = 1 048 576 байт):

5 760 000 / 1 048 576 ≈ 5,49 мегабайт

Наиболее близкое число к размеру полученного файла, выраженному в мегабайтах, будет 5,49 мегабайт.

avatar
ответил 4 месяца назад

Ваш ответ

Вопросы по теме